Cultural Academy Employees Allege Salary Delay on Eid, Raise Discrimination Concerns
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

 

Srinagar, Mar 23 (JKNS): Employees of the Cultural Academy have alleged that they were not paid their salaries on the occasion of Eid, expressing concern over delays and alleged disparity in wage disbursement.

As per reports received by news agency JKNS, employees claimed that neither staff in Jammu nor in Srinagar were paid, despite expectations that salaries would be released ahead of Eid. They alleged that while payments were reportedly made during Diwali earlier, no such consideration was extended on Eid, leading to resentment among workers.

The employees further stated that many of them are under financial stress as bank loan instalments and interest deductions continue despite non-payment of salaries, adding to their hardship.

They also alleged that the department had sufficient revenue generated from facilities like Abhinav Theatre and Tagore Hall, which could have been utilised to clear pending dues.

The employees have urged the authorities to intervene and ensure timely release of salaries, particularly during important occasions, to avoid further distress. (JKNS)
